Output 508362a94a189ad3c494ab898ce2ca26705ad1edc03cb0de9212ce2097ac4f34:1

value
669816734
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f52e11842a5ec520d7bc837e30f99b337d240779 OP_EQUALVERIFY OP_CHECKSIG
address
1PMPjtYEJdWTpKGhV5YX766XuPS1YDr2d6
transaction
508362a94a189ad3c494ab898ce2ca26705ad1edc03cb0de9212ce2097ac4f34
spent
true